Structure and Time Commitment

Standard CPR certification classes are typically brief. Most basic courses for the general public take approximately two to four hours to complete and often include Automated External Defibrillator (AED) training. Courses that combine CPR with comprehensive First Aid training may extend to four to six hours.

Many providers offer flexible learning options, such as blended or hybrid courses. Participants complete the cognitive, or knowledge-based, portion of the training online at their own pace. This is followed by a mandatory in-person session focused on hands-on skills practice and evaluation.

Learning the Fundamentals

The cognitive part of a CPR class focuses on understanding when and why intervention is necessary. Instructors emphasize recognizing the signs of cardiac arrest, such as unresponsiveness and the absence of normal breathing. Students learn the importance of quickly activating the emergency response system, like calling 9-1-1, before starting care.

A core principle taught is the C-A-B sequence: Compressions, Airway, and Breathing. This sequence prioritizes immediate chest compressions to circulate oxygenated blood, a change from older guidelines. Understanding this revised order ensures that blood flow is restored with minimal delay.

Students also learn about Good Samaritan laws, which protect rescuers who provide care in good faith. This legal context helps alleviate anxiety about potential liability when assisting a person in an emergency. The focus remains on rapid decision-making and following standardized steps until professional help arrives.

Mastering the Physical Skills

The hands-on portion addresses the physical performance of the technique. CPR requires maintaining a precise compression rate of 100 to 120 compressions per minute, often timed to the rhythm of a familiar song like “Stayin’ Alive”. For adults, the compression depth must be at least 2 inches, but not exceed 2.4 inches, to effectively move blood without causing unnecessary injury.

Participants practice these skills on specialized manikins that include feedback devices to ensure they are meeting the correct depth and rate. This immediate, objective feedback helps students adjust their technique until it meets professional standards. Practice sessions are structured to allow for rest and rotation, mimicking the two-minute cycles recommended for real-life emergencies.

Training also includes the proper use of an Automated External Defibrillator (AED), which is a device that can analyze heart rhythm and deliver an electrical shock. Students learn how to power on the device, attach the electrode pads, and follow the simple voice prompts. This instruction ensures that the crucial step of defibrillation is not delayed.

Assessment and Certification Process

The final stage involves a two-part assessment to confirm competency before certification is awarded. The cognitive assessment is usually a written, multiple-choice exam covering material like recognizing emergencies and understanding the C-A-B sequence. Passing this test demonstrates a sufficient grasp of the foundational knowledge required.

The second part is the practical skills test, where students must successfully demonstrate the correct technique on a manikin. Instructors observe the performance, evaluating factors like hand placement, compression depth, and the ability to deliver effective rescue breaths. Students are given opportunities to practice and receive corrective feedback before the final evaluation. Certification is issued upon successful completion of both components and is typically valid for two years before a refresher course is required.
